What sort of activities do you do during sessions?

Emphasis is placed on play; specific activities are tailored to each individual. Some examples include:

  • Movement – We often involve movement during visits. Movement therapy can include swinging (we love using stretchy Lycra swings!), jumping, crashing, climbing, and yoga. Movement can be one of the fastest ways to learn how to regulate the body!
  • Parent support – sharing resources, problem solving, and tailoring support to your child.
  • Regulation – Body-based activities such as breathing, and improving awareness of how your body is feeling.

As parents and guardians, do we need to be present for the sessions?

We like to include parents, especially with younger children—you’re their safe person! Some children in certain age ranges enjoy 1-on-1 sessions, and in these cases, we invite parents into the session to model activities and demonstrate some of the practices we tried that day. Of course, every family dynamic is different, and the exact extent of parental involvement will reflect that.
